A great German import release featuring the West Side Chicago blues of little-known (outside of the Windy City) Larry Taylor and his family. Little Larry grew up in a literal house of the blues as famous bluesmen such as Muddy Waters, Howlin' Wolf, Jimmy Reed and Elmore James were regular visitors, jamming with Larry's stepdad and chowing down on his mom's legendary soul food cooking. Larry got the blues deep down and played as a kid and young man, in bands led by other Chicago greats. In 2000, he began to lead his own bands. This release is a bit of "greatest hits" package, pulling from Taylor's work from 1987 to today. With all of the hype South Side Chicago blues music gets, it is easy to overlook the West Side -- just as gritty, just as soul-stirring, just as excellent. Check out the Howlin' Wolf tune "I Didn't Want to Hurt Your Feelings," "Knocking at Your Door" and "Green Line Blues" (I took that same "L" train line as a kid).
